This feature is not exposed directly to >>> web developers or users. However, HTTPS adoption is now standard practice >>> (>90% of page loads in Chrome use HTTPS), and automatically upgrading >>> navigations to HTTPS would avoid unnecessary redirects from HTTP to HTTPS >>> for site owners. The `upgrade-insecure-requests` header has some similar >>> functionality, and according to HTTP-Archive is found on ~6% of all >>> requests. >>> >>> *Other signals*: >>> >>> WebView application risks >>> >>> Does this intent deprecate or change behavior of existing APIs, such >>> that it has potentially high risk for Android WebView-based applications? >>> >>> >>> >>> Debuggability >>> >>> Chrome will upgrade these navigations to HTTPS using a 307 internal >>> redirect, which will be visible in the Network panel of Developer Tools. >>> >> >> For HSTS, we synthesize a `Non-Authoritative-Reason` header on the >> synthetic redirect that tells developers why the redirect happened. Just enterprise policy work, or >> are there other things embedders would need to implement to make this >> functionality work? >> > > This feature is currently implemented in //chrome with some support code > in content/'s NavigationRequest. I think it would be feasible to migrate > the core of this into content/ -- we use an URLRequestLoaderInterceptor and > a NavigationThrottle to implement the upgrading and fallback logic. This is > currently shared with Chrome's HTTPS-First Mode (controlled by Chrome's > "Always use secure connections" setting). If we did migrate this logic to > content/, embedders would need to add their own support for at least (1) > how to handle allowlisting hostnames, and (2) enterprise policies for > enabling/disabling the feature and exempting hostnames.
